CREATE SEQUENCE ORACLE
--sintaxis del create sequence
Create sequence NOMBRESECUENCIA
Start with VALORENTERO
Increment by VALORENTERO
Maxvalue VALORENTERO
Minvalue VALORENTERO
Cycle | Nocycle;
--CREACION DE TABLE EN ORACLE
CREATE TABLE DISTRITO
(
IDDISTRITO NUMBER(5),
CODDISTRITO VARCHAR2(5),
NOMBRE VARCHAR2(60),
CONSTRAINT PK_ID_DIST PRIMARY KEY(IDDISTRITO)
);
--CREACION DE SECUENCIA EN ORACLE
CREATE SEQUENCE SQ_ID_DISTRITO
Start with 1
Increment by 1
Minvalue 1
Maxvalue 99999
Nocycle;
--PROBANDO SECUENCIA EN ORACLE
INSERT INTO DISTRITO(IDDISTRITO,CODDISTRITO,NOMBRE)
VALUES(SQ_ID_DISTRITO.NEXTVAL, 'DISJL','SAN JUAN DE LURIGANCHO');
INSERT INTO DISTRITO(IDDISTRITO,CODDISTRITO,NOMBRE)
VALUES(SQ_ID_DISTRITO.NEXTVAL, 'DISJM','SAN JUAN DE MIRAFLORES');
INSERT INTO DISTRITO(IDDISTRITO,CODDISTRITO,NOMBRE)
VALUES(SQ_ID_DISTRITO.NEXTVAL, 'DIVMT','VILLA MARIA DEL TRIUNFO');
SELECT * FROM DISTRITO;
By: Ing. Jhonatan Abal Mejia
Create sequence NOMBRESECUENCIA
Start with VALORENTERO
Increment by VALORENTERO
Maxvalue VALORENTERO
Minvalue VALORENTERO
Cycle | Nocycle;
--CREACION DE TABLE EN ORACLE
CREATE TABLE DISTRITO
(
IDDISTRITO NUMBER(5),
CODDISTRITO VARCHAR2(5),
NOMBRE VARCHAR2(60),
CONSTRAINT PK_ID_DIST PRIMARY KEY(IDDISTRITO)
);
--CREACION DE SECUENCIA EN ORACLE
CREATE SEQUENCE SQ_ID_DISTRITO
Start with 1
Increment by 1
Minvalue 1
Maxvalue 99999
Nocycle;
--PROBANDO SECUENCIA EN ORACLE
INSERT INTO DISTRITO(IDDISTRITO,CODDISTRITO,NOMBRE)
VALUES(SQ_ID_DISTRITO.NEXTVAL, 'DISJL','SAN JUAN DE LURIGANCHO');
INSERT INTO DISTRITO(IDDISTRITO,CODDISTRITO,NOMBRE)
VALUES(SQ_ID_DISTRITO.NEXTVAL, 'DISJM','SAN JUAN DE MIRAFLORES');
INSERT INTO DISTRITO(IDDISTRITO,CODDISTRITO,NOMBRE)
VALUES(SQ_ID_DISTRITO.NEXTVAL, 'DIVMT','VILLA MARIA DEL TRIUNFO');
SELECT * FROM DISTRITO;
By: Ing. Jhonatan Abal Mejia
Comentarios